Harbor link – Albany Entertainment Centre design by Steve Woodland




Provided by notable furniture in Cambodia construction materials, designed by Steve Woodland, this grand-scale building is the Albany Entertainment Centre. It helps initiate the link of the city to the harbor.

"With this complex, for the first time the city is reaching out to the harbor, and the theatre is the focal point for reuniting the two sectors. This project carries with it a responsibility for bringing people to the water's edge, and a lot of planning has gone into creating a public domain," Woodland said. "On such a beautiful site, the visual character of the building is particularly important. It can be seen from all around the harbor and from the town."

"And, because the center is so visible from the harbor, we wanted to create an undulating form that relates to the undulations of the land behind the town. The folded shape of the building is designed to loosely follow the silhouette of the local topography," added Woodland.
